Exhibition of Minerals and Fossils

The Exhibition of Minerals and Fossils was founded in 2006 in Perissa by the Cultural Society of Thira. It is located near the Cathedral of the Holy Cross. Here you can see minerals and fossils from Thira, the rest of Greece and abroad. The oldest of the exhibits date back to 1.5 billion years ago while the newest are 50,000 years old.

Some of the most important fossils are the vegetable fossils of olive, mastic tree and palm tree from the Caldera of Santorini. These fossils are the proof of past evolution of plants in the wider European area.
